Line protection MCCB with thermal-magnetic release
The Siemens 3VA1150-4ED42-0AA0 is a SENTRON molded case circuit breaker (MCCB) configured for line protection, meaning it guards distribution feeders and branch circuits against overload and short-circuit conditions without integrated communication or ground-fault monitoring. It carries a rated continuous current Iu of 50 A and a rated insulation voltage Ui of 800 V, with a 4-pole design that handles three-phase plus neutral or switched-neutral applications in panelboards and switchgear assemblies.
Breaking capacity — what the voltage columns mean for your fault-current study
This MCCB's interrupting rating varies sharply with system voltage: 121 kA at 240 V AC, 76 kA at 415 V, 53 kA at 440 V, and 11.9 kA at both 500 V and 690 V. The 121 kA figure at 240 V makes it suitable for high-fault locations like transformer secondaries or large motor control centers on 240 V delta systems. At 415 V, the 76 kA rating still covers most industrial distribution panels; the drop to 11.9 kA above 500 V means the breaker is not a primary choice for 690 V drives or mining equipment unless the available fault current is confirmed below that threshold. For DC networks, the maximum rated operational voltage Ue is 600 V DC — consult the 3VA device manual for DC-specific derating and switching limits.
Thermal derating and TM210 release characteristics
The TM210 overcurrent release is a thermal-magnetic design: the thermal element tracks RMS current for overload protection, and the magnetic trip handles short-circuit events. At 40 °C, 45 °C, and 50 °C ambient, the breaker holds its full 50 A rating without derating. Above 50 °C, the continuous current capability declines linearly — 49 A at 55 °C, 48 A at 60 °C, 46 A at 65 °C, and 45 A at 70 °C. If the panel ambient runs above 50 °C, size the continuous load at the derated value, not the nameplate 50 A. The operating temperature range spans -40 °C to 70 °C; storage range extends to 80 °C maximum.
Panel fit and mounting dimensions
The 3VA1150-4ED42-0AA0 measures 130 mm high, 101.6 mm wide, and 70 mm deep — a 4-pole MCCB that occupies roughly 4 inches of DIN-rail or panel-mount width. The IP40 front protection means the breaker face is protected against tools and solid objects larger than 1 mm but not sealed against moisture; install in a dry enclosure or a panel with a higher-rated door. Maximum power loss is 14.6 W, which should be factored into enclosure thermal calculations when multiple breakers are ganged.
